DUI Driver Almost Hits 1 Naugatuck Police Officer, Then Hits Police Cruiser: Police

Naugatuck police say the accused, who was charged on an arrest warrant, almost hit a police officer who was directing traffic.

Naugatuck, CT - An allegedly intoxicated driver almost struck a borough police officer directing traffic and then ended up striking a police cruiser, police said in a news release.

Police said Joshua C. Thomas, 26, of Guernsey Lane in New Milford, was arrested on a warrant on July 16 for an incident that occurred on June 16.

Police said Thomas was driving erratically on Cherry Street and almost struck the officer, Carl Schaaf, who was directing traffic.

Thomas' vehicle then ran into a police car driven by Officer John Julian on Cherry Street, police said.

Thomas is charged with DUI, reckless driving, evading responsibility, second-degree reckless endangerment, and failure to obey a police officer's signal.
